Advantages of Household Diesel Generator
 

High Energy Efficiency
The main advantage of diesel engines lies in their superior fuel efficiency. Diesel engines employ a high-compression-ratio compression ignition system, resulting in higher thermal conversion efficiency than most light-duty generators. At the same power output, diesel engines consume significantly less fuel than gasoline engines, reducing daily operating costs and alleviating the pressure of fuel storage and replenishment. Diesel fuel has low volatility and a high flash point, minimizing safety hazards during storage and helping to provide long-term backup power in case of unexpected power outages.

 

High Stability
Diesel engines offer stable output and strong load capacity. They provide sufficient torque even at low speeds, maintaining stable power generation for extended periods. Diesel engines adapt well to sudden load changes, effectively ensuring the safe operation of critical electrical equipment such as refrigerators, lighting, heating, and medical equipment, preventing malfunctions or shortened lifespans due to power fluctuations.

 

Wide Adaptability
Diesel generators have broad environmental adaptability. They are highly tolerant of changes in temperature, humidity, and altitude, enabling smooth starting and performance maintenance in cold, hot, humid, and high-altitude environments. Therefore, they are less affected by external climatic conditions than gasoline engines. Modern diesel generators typically incorporate noise reduction and exhaust purification designs, making them more suitable for residential environments with their noise and emission requirements.

 

Long Service Life
Diesel engines combine durability and ease of maintenance. Their robust construction and excellent wear resistance in key components result in a long service life and flexible maintenance schedules, helping to reduce total lifecycle maintenance costs. Some models are also equipped with intelligent control systems that enable automatic switching, overload protection, and status monitoring, thereby enhancing safety and convenience.

Components of Household Diesel Generator

 

 
 

Engine

The engine is the core of a diesel generator. It burns fuel to convert chemical energy into mechanical energy, driving the system.

 
 

Alternator

The alternator converts the mechanical energy from the engine into electrical energy, ensuring the generator supplies electricity efficiently.

 
 

Fuel System

The fuel system includes the fuel tank, pump, and injectors. It ensures a consistent fuel supply to the engine for combustion.

 
 

Cooling System

Diesel generators produce significant heat during operation. The cooling system, made up of radiators and fans, dissipates heat to maintain optimal temperature levels and prevent overheating.

 
 

Lubrication System

The lubrication system uses oil to reduce friction between moving parts, ensuring smooth operation and extending the lifespan of the components.

 
 

Exhaust System

This system manages and expels the gases produced during combustion. Advanced exhaust systems in modern generators help meet environmental standards by controlling emissions.

 
 

Control Panel

The control panel allows operators to monitor and manage the generator's performance, displaying vital information such as voltage, current, and frequency.

 
 

Battery

The battery powers the starter motor, enabling quick engine start-up.

 

Types of Household Diesel Generator

 

Classification by Power Rating

Small Household Diesel Generators: Small generators typically have a power output between 3kW and 8kW. They are compact, fuel-efficient, and suitable for basic emergency power needs in ordinary households, such as lighting, refrigerators, and small appliances.

 

Medium Household Diesel Generators: Medium-sized generators have a power output of approximately 10kW to 20kW. They can power high-power equipment such as air conditioners and water heaters, meeting the needs of multi-room households or households with higher comfort requirements.

Classification by Cooling Method

Air-Cooled Diesel Generators: Air-cooled generators rely on fans and radiators for heat exchange. They have a simple structure, require no additional water source, and are easy to move and use temporarily outdoors. However, their heat dissipation efficiency is limited under continuous high-power operation.

 

Water-Cooled Diesel Generators: Water-cooled units use a circulating water system and radiators, providing stable heat dissipation performance. They are suitable for long-term continuous power supply and are mostly used in fixed-installation household settings.

Classification by Starting Method

Electric-Start Diesel Generators: Electric-start units are equipped with batteries and a starter motor. They are easy to operate and, with an automatic switching controller, can quickly connect to the grid after a power outage.

 

Manually Started Diesel Generators: Manually started generator sets require no batteries, have a simpler structure, and are suitable for users with weak power infrastructure or those seeking maintenance-free operation; however, their emergency response speed is not as fast as that of electrically started generator sets.

Classification by Functional Configuration

Standard Diesel Generators: Standard generator sets focus on basic power generation performance, featuring manual start/stop and overload protection.

 

Intelligent Diesel Generators: Intelligent generator sets integrate digital control panels, remote monitoring, automatic voltage regulation, and fault diagnosis functions. They can provide real-time feedback on operating status, optimize energy consumption management, and thus improve ease of use and safety.

Q: What is the lifespan of a diesel generator?

A: The lifespan of a diesel generator depends on the quality of the unit, maintenance, and usage. On average, a well-maintained diesel generator can last between 10,000 and 30,000 hours of operation, which translates to approximately 10 to 20 years for most commercial applications.

Q: Are diesel generators environmentally friendly?

A: Diesel generators emit greenhouse gases, including carbon dioxide (CO2), nitrogen oxides (NOx), and particulate matter. However, modern diesel generators are designed with better fuel efficiency and reduced emissions, helping to mitigate environmental impact. Furthermore, diesel generators are often more fuel-efficient compared to other backup power solutions, such as gasoline-powered generators.

Q: How does a domestic diesel generator work?

A: A domestic diesel generator works by converting diesel fuel into electrical energy through an internal combustion process. When the generator is started, diesel fuel is injected into the engine's combustion chamber, where it is ignited by the heat of compressed air. This combustion creates a high-pressure force that moves the engine's pistons, driving a crankshaft. The crankshaft, in turn, rotates the generator's rotor within a magnetic field, inducing an electrical current. This current is then conditioned and distributed to power household appliances and systems. The generator typically includes a fuel tank, engine, alternator, and control systems to manage its operation and output.

Q: Are domestic diesel generators the same as silent diesel generators?

A: Domestic diesel generators and silent diesel generators are not always identical. Domestic diesel generators are intended for household use, supplying backup power during power outages. In contrast, silent diesel generators are designed to operate with minimal noise, making them ideal for noise-sensitive settings. While a domestic diesel generator can also be a silent type, not all domestic generators are equipped with silent features.
